O’Connor Leads Tigers After Opening Round of American Conference Championships
Apr 27, 2026 | Men's Golf
SARASOTA, Fla. – The University of Memphis men's golf team delivered a powerful opening-round performance Monday, finishing day one of the American Conference Championships in a tie for second place.

Competing at The Ritz-Carlton Members Club, the Tigers carded a 16-under-par 272. Memphis ties with Rice and remains just one stroke behind the leader, Charlotte (-17).
Senior Cian O'Connor surged to the top of the individual leaderboard, firing a 7-under-par 65. O'Connor holds a one-stroke lead over Charlotte's Seb Cave heading into the second round of play.
Diego Lourenco backed O'Connor's performance with a 5-under 67 to sit in seventh place, while Yixiang Wang and Christian Morneau both carded rounds of 2-under-par 70 to end the day tied for 14th.
The Tigers look to maintain their momentum during the second round of The American championships, which begins Tuesday, April 28.
